Using my new Canon photo/video gear, I put this video together of former Olympian Zola Budd training last week at Coastal Carolina University. Luckily, I just added two Canon 5D Mark II cameras that replaced my aging EOS 1D Mark IIs.
So far I like the video features but I wish the cameras had a controllable and movable video monitor, which could be pulled out and adjusted when you shoot low angles.
Another negative is the inability to monitor the sound input when using external mics. On windy days like the day I shot this video that is a big problem.
All in all this is the camera that finally helps me forget the old days of film. The quality of the still images is wonderful and getting back the full use of my lenses with the full-frame sensor is a big improvement.
